2. Safety Instructions
WARNING: Failure to follow these safety instructions may result in serious injury or death.
- Consult a physician before beginning any exercise program.
- Ensure all bolts, nuts, and connections are securely tightened before each use.
- Inspect the power rack for any damaged or worn parts before each workout. Do not use if damaged.
- Always use safety spotter arms when performing exercises like squats or bench presses, especially when lifting heavy weights or training alone.
- Do not exceed the maximum weight capacity of the rack or its components.
- Keep children and pets away from the equipment during use.
- Use the equipment on a flat, stable surface.
- Wear appropriate athletic footwear and clothing.
- Perform exercises with controlled movements. Avoid sudden or jerky motions.
- If you experience pain, dizziness, or shortness of breath, stop exercising immediately.

4. Setup & Assembly
Assembly typically requires two people. Ensure you have adequate space and all tools provided or required (e.g., adjustable wrench, socket wrench).
4.1 Unpacking and Preparation
- Carefully unpack all components and lay them out on a clean, flat surface.
- Cross-reference all parts with the package contents list to ensure nothing is missing.
- Keep all packaging materials until assembly is complete in case of returns or missing parts.
4.2 Frame Assembly
- Attach the base frames to the bottom crossmembers using the provided bolts and nuts. Do not fully tighten yet.
- Connect the four uprights to the base frames. Ensure the uprights are oriented correctly (e.g., holes facing inward for attachments).
- Attach the top crossmembers to the uprights.
- Once the main frame is assembled, gradually tighten all bolts and nuts, ensuring the rack is square and stable.

5.1 Adjusting J-Hooks and Safety Spotter Arms
- To adjust, remove the J-hooks or safety spotter arms from their current position.
- Align them with the desired holes on the uprights. Ensure both sides are at the same height.
- Fully insert the pins to secure them in place. For safety spotter arms, ensure they are locked.
- Recommendation: For squats, set the J-hooks slightly below shoulder height. For bench press, set them at a height that allows you to unrack the bar with a slight elbow bend. Set safety spotter arms just below your lowest point of movement for squats or chest level for bench press.
5.2 Performing Exercises
- Squats: Position the barbell on the J-hooks. Step under the bar, unrack, and step back. Perform squats within the rack, ensuring the safety spotter arms are set correctly.
- Bench Press: Position a weight bench inside the rack. Set the J-hooks and safety spotter arms to appropriate heights. Lie on the bench, unrack the bar, and perform the exercise.
- Pull-ups/Chin-ups: Use the multi-grip pull-up bar for various grip positions.
- Cable Exercises (if applicable): If your rack includes a cable system, attach appropriate handles and perform exercises like lat pulldowns, cable rows, tricep pushdowns, or cable curls.
- Weight Plate Storage: Utilize the integrated weight plate storage pegs to keep your gym organized and for added stability to the rack.
6. Maintenance
Regular maintenance ensures the longevity and safe operation of your Atletica R7 Forge Power Rack.
- Daily: Wipe down the rack with a damp cloth after each use to remove sweat and dust.
- Weekly: Inspect all bolts, nuts, and connections for tightness. Retighten as necessary.
- Monthly: Check for any signs of wear, rust, or damage on the frame, J-hooks, safety spotter arms, and pull-up bar. Pay close attention to welds and moving parts (if applicable, like a cable system).
- Lubrication (if applicable): If your rack includes a cable system, periodically lubricate the pulleys and cables with a silicone-based lubricant to ensure smooth operation.
- Do not use abrasive cleaners or solvents, as these can damage the finish.
7. Troubleshooting
This section addresses common issues you might encounter with your power rack.
| Problem | Possible Cause | Solution |
|---|---|---|
| Rack feels unstable or wobbly. | Loose bolts or uneven floor. | Ensure all assembly bolts are fully tightened. Check if the floor is level; use shims if necessary. |
| J-hooks or safety spotter arms are difficult to insert/remove. | Holes are not aligned, or pins are bent. | Ensure the rack is square. Check pins for damage. Apply a small amount of silicone spray if friction is high. |
| Squeaking noises during use (if cable system is present). | Dry pulleys or cables. | Lubricate pulleys and cables with a silicone-based lubricant. |
